#bd329c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bd329c is composed of 74.1% red, 19.6% green and 61.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 73.5% magenta, 17.5%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 314.2 degrees, a saturation of 58.2% and a lightness of 46.9%. #bd329c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ff64ff with #7b0039.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

#bd329c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bd329c has RGB values of R:189, G:50, B:156 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.74, Y:0.17,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 12399260.
